What Causes Stiffness In The Elbow?

I have a stiffness feeling in my elbow sometimes and it also travels to my wrist at times it has been doing this on and off for a few months now.....Im not in any sports however I do retail work and it involves heavy lifting at times. What could this be

Orthopaedic Surgeon 's  Response
hi you have stiffness in your elbow and sometimes it travels to wrist. Your job involves heavy weight lifting. With stiffness in your elbow , esp with pain and nature of your job , I am inclined to think in terms of Tennis Elbow - take pain killers for few days and avoid heavy weight lifting for the time being. Sometimes the problem is self limiting and may not need anything further.
